The motor vehicles and motorcycles sector in the UK is projected to grow steadily from 2024 to 2028. Starting at £60.51 billion in 2024, the sector's output is expected to increase annually by approximately 1.6%, reaching £64.29 billion by 2028. With no actual data for 2023 provided, the 2024 forecast indicates a continuation of positive trends seen in earlier years.
Key future trends to watch for:
- The impact of electric vehicle adoption on sector production and repair services.
- The influence of technological advancements such as AI and IoT in vehicle sales and maintenance.
- Potential regulatory shifts and sustainability efforts influencing production and supply chains.
